Vue.js是现代前端开发的新兴框架,以其灵活、易用和高效的特点成为开发者们的首选。它采用响应式编程模式,能够实现数据变化与视图更新的自动同步,极大地简化了开发过程。Vue.js注重组件化开发,使得代码可维护性和复用性大大提高。Vue.js为前端开发带来了新的篇章,推动了前端开发技术的发展。
本文目录导读:
随着互联网的快速发展,前端开发的技术也在不断进步,Vue.js作为一种新兴的JavaScript框架,凭借其简洁、灵活和高效的特点,迅速成为了前端开发领域的热门技术,本文将详细介绍Vue.js的基本概念、特点、应用场景以及如何使用Vue.js进行开发。
Vue.js概述
Vue.js是一个构建用户界面的渐进式框架,旨在通过简洁的API实现响应式数据绑定和组合视图组件,与其他前端框架相比,Vue.js具有以下几个显著特点:
1、简单易学:Vue.js的API简洁明了,易于上手。
2、灵活性强:Vue.js采用组件化开发模式,可按需加载,适应不同规模的项目。
3、数据双向绑定:Vue.js实现数据双向绑定,使数据与视图之间的同步更加便捷。
4、生态系统完善:Vue.js拥有完善的生态系统,包括丰富的插件、工具和库。
Vue.js的主要特点
1、响应式数据绑定:Vue.js通过响应式系统,自动更新视图,无需手动操作DOM。
2、组件化开发:Vue.js采用组件化开发模式,便于代码复用和模块化管理。
3、指令与插槽:Vue.js提供丰富的内置指令和插槽功能,方便实现各种复杂交互和布局。
4、虚拟DOM:Vue.js采用虚拟DOM技术,提高性能并减少直接操作DOM带来的问题。
5、插件化系统:Vue.js支持插件,可轻松扩展功能。
Vue.js的应用场景
Vue.js适用于各种规模的前端开发项目,特别是在以下场景中具有显著优势:
1、单页应用(SPA):Vue.js适用于构建单页应用,通过路由实现页面跳转,提高用户体验。
2、复杂交互:Vue.js的指令和插槽功能便于实现各种复杂交互效果,适用于需要丰富交互的项目。
3、数据可视化:结合第三方库,如ECharts、D3等,Vue.js可实现数据可视化。
4、移动端开发:Vue.js可轻松构建移动端应用,与移动端的交互更加流畅。
如何使用Vue.js进行开发
使用Vue.js进行开发需要掌握以下几个关键步骤:
1、环境搭建:安装Node.js和npm,使用Vue CLI创建项目。
2、组件化开发:按照功能划分组件,实现代码复用和模块化。
3、数据绑定与交互:使用v-bind、v-on等指令实现数据绑定和交互。
4、路由与状态管理:使用Vue Router实现路由管理,使用Vuex进行状态管理。
5、调试与优化:使用开发者工具进行调试,优化性能并修复问题。
Vue.js作为一种新兴的JavaScript框架,凭借其简洁、灵活和高效的特点,在前端开发领域具有广泛的应用前景,随着技术的不断发展,Vue.js将继续优化和完善其功能,为开发者提供更加便捷的开发体验,我们可以期待Vue.js在更多领域得到应用,推动前端开发技术的进步。
本文详细介绍了Vue.js的基本概念、特点、应用场景以及如何使用Vue.js进行开发,希望通过本文的介绍,读者能对Vue.js有更深入的了解,并在实际项目中应用Vue.js,提高开发效率与项目质量。